On Fri, 2011-04-22 at 12:13 -0700, Mark S. Townsley wrote:
> It looks like the virtual keyboard will automatically show
> up/available for any text input.   For example, I have an QML app and
> the virtual keyboard shows up automatically under my TextInput area
> during run time.
> 
> Is this assumption correct (virtual keyboard is available
> automatically for any text input fields)?

Yes, it is correct. But I keep thinking that this concept really only
works out for small form factors (such as handset UX). For tablet UX and
bigger (say, on the desktop), the Qt default of "first touch to focus,
and second touch to bring up VKB" feels better.
